Answer the following statement(s) true (T) or false (F)

1. Status epilepticus causes death in 10 percent of cases.
2. Tonic-clonic movements are usually seen in petit mal seizures.
3. It is best to use fixed dental appliances, if possible, when dealing with an epileptic.
4. Dilantin hyperplasia occurs in some epileptics as a result of taking dilantin.
5. Every epileptic experiences the same type of aura.


1. True
2. False
3. True
4. True
5. False
